Correction
April 27, 2022

Errors in Table 1

JAMA Dermatol. 2022;158(6):706. doi:10.1001/jamadermatol.2022.1379

In the Original Investigation titled “Assessing the Potential for Patient-led Surveillance After Treatment of Localized Melanoma (MEL-SELF): A Pilot Randomized Clinical Trial,”1 published online on November 24, 2021, in JAMA Dermatology, there were 2 minor errors in Table 1. The number of participants with 1 melanoma was adjusted from a total of 77 to 76, and for 3 melanomas, from 10 to 11. The respective percentages were adjusted as well. These changes did not affect the results of the data analysis. This article was corrected online.
